Abraham Lincoln in the post-heroic era : history and memory in late twentieth-century America / Barry Schwartz.

Author: Schwartz, Barry, 1938-

Publisher: Chicago : University of Chicago Press, 2008.

ISBN: 9780226741888 (cloth : alk. paper)
0226741885 (cloth : alk. paper)

Description: xvi, 394 p. : ill. ; 24 cm.

Subject: Lincoln, Abraham, 1809-1865.
Lincoln, Abraham, 1809-1865 Public opinion.
Lincoln, Abraham, 1809-1865 Influence.
Presidents United States Biography.
Multiculturalism United States.
United States History 20th century.

Contents: Ascension : Lincoln in the Depression -- Apex : Lincoln in the Second World War -- Transition : Cold War, racial conflict, and contested images of Lincoln -- Transfiguration : civil rights movement, vanishing savior of the Union -- Erosion : fading prestige, benign ridicule -- Post-heroic era : acids of equality and the waning of greatness -- Inertia : the enduring Lincoln.
